You perform the following steps to assign communication components to the application components of the process integration scenario.
Which communication components you can assign depends on how you defined the application component when you designed the process integration scenario.
In the following, application components of type External Party with B2B Communication are B2B Components.
Application components that are not B2B components are Internal Application Components.

Relationship Between Application Component and Assignable Communication Components
Application Component |
Assignable Communication Components |
Internal application component (without assigned integration process) |
One or more business system components. One or more business components (only if the application component has at least one connection to a B2B component; in this case, the assignments between the business components and business system components must match) |
Internal application component (with assigned integration process) |
Exactly one integration process component Exactly one business component (only if the application component has at least one connection to a B2B component; in this case, the assignment between the business component and integration process component must match) |
B2B Component |
One or more business components. |
If an internal application component has at least one connection to a B2B component, use business components as neutral representatives for communication with the external party. The assignments between business components and business system components, and between business components and integration process components define which business systems or integration processes from your internal system landscape are mapped to which (externally visible) business services: this results in an appropriate header mapping in the receiver agreement that is generated.

To call the function for assigning communication components, choose Assign Components ().
A screen area is displayed in which you can make your assignments for the selected application component. The navigation arrows ( and ) enable you to navigate between the application components in the integration scenario.
Depending on the type of application component, you can perform the following activities.
Once you have made the necessary entries, confirm them by choosing Assign.

1. On the Business System Components for A2A tab page you assign the relevant business system components in a table (one line per communication component).
To select the business system components, use input help (F4 help in the Communication Component column).
If you want to create a new business system component, on the Business System Components for A2A tab page choose Create Communication Components for Business Systems ().
More information: Defining a Business System as a Communication Component
The following steps are then only required if the application component has at least one connection to a B2B component.
2. On the Business Components for B2B tab page, enter the business components that you want to use for B2B communication.
3. Assign the relevant business systems from your internal system landscape to each business component.
You can select the communication components for the business systems that you specified on the Business System Components for A2A tab page from the input help.

1. On the Integration Process Component for A2A tab page, you assign an integration process.
All the integration process components that are based on the integration process that the application component is assigned to are available for selection in the input help.
2. If you want to create a new integration process component choose Create New Object ().
More information: Defining Integration Processes as Communication Components
The following steps are then only required if the application component has at least one connection to a B2B component.
3. On the Business Components for B2B tab page, enter the business component that you want to use for B2B communication.
The integration process component that is already entered on the Integration Process Component for A2A tab page is then assigned to this business component.
